About Quaneisha
Welcome! I’m Quaneisha Browning, a Louisiana Licensed Clinical Social Worker and the founder of Anchored Hope Counseling and Consulting. I have extensive experience in behavioral health and am passionate about helping individuals and families navigate life’s challenges with compassion, evidence-based care, and hope. I earned my Master of Social Work from The University of Southern Mississippi in Hattiesburg and my Master of Christian Education from New Orleans Baptist Theological Seminary.
In addition to providing counseling services, I enjoy teaching and speaking on topics related to mental health, trauma, and social work. I have taught at universities throughout the New Orleans area, presented at NASW-Louisiana conferences and events, and trained residents at Louisiana State Penitentiary (Angola) in layperson grief counseling. These experiences have reinforced my commitment to equipping others with practical tools to support healing within their communities.
